Facebook starts testing their mobile advertising platform
TechCrunch has blogged about the new mobile advertising platform being tested by Facebook with a limited number of partners.

Facebook is going to let advertisers target mobile users based on their interests, location and other parameters that is already available with Facebook.
The company ensures that user privacy has been given a top priority. Advertisers would not be given details that could identify the user.
The whole idea is focused on letting ads powered by Facebook platform run inside third party apps or websites on mobile devices.
